Kuehn, Bonnie Lou (Marriage - 29 September 1973)

The marriage of Miss Bonnie Lou Kuehn of Granton and Jerome Edward Jordan of Neillsville was solemnized September 29 in a 7 p.m. ceremony performed at Zion Lutheran Church, Granton, by the Rev. Roland Roehrs. Following the ceremony a reception was held at the home of the bride’s parents, Mr. and Mrs. Lester Kuehn, Rt. 2 Granton. The groom is the son of Mrs. Bernice Shrove, Rockford, Il.

A white satin A-line gown styled with lace bodice and sleeves was chosen by the former Miss Kuehn. Lace trim on her veil matched the lace of the gown. She carried a bouquet of peppermint carnations as she was presented in marriage by her father.

The couple’s attendants were Miss Jeanette Kuehn and Rick Kuehn, both of Granton. Miss Kuehn’s pink satin A-line gown, fashioned with lace bodice and sleeves, was complimented by an arrangement of peppermint carnations.

Dennis and Dale Kuehn served as ushers. Mrs. Helm was the organist

The newlyweds are living on Rt. 2 Granton. The groom is employed by a Marshfield firm.
